Can bitter melon and cauliflower be eaten together?

Bitter melon and cauliflower are both nutrient-rich vegetables containing vitamins, minerals, and dietary fiber. Bitter melon is rich in vitamin C and bitter melon glycosides, and has effects of clearing heat, detoxifying, and lowering blood sugar. Cauliflower is rich in vitamin K, vitamin C, and folic acid, which can promote bone health and antioxidant activity. Combining these two vegetables in the diet not only complements each other in taste but also provides more comprehensive nutrition.

Generally speaking, bitter melon and cauliflower can be eaten together. Details are as follows:

From the perspective of food pairing, there is no obvious incompatibility between bitter melon and cauliflower. Bitter melon is rich in nutrients such as vitamin C, bitter principles, and dietary fiber, which can help clear heat and toxins, lower blood sugar levels, and promote digestion. Cauliflower is rich in dietary fiber, vitamins, folic acid, and other nutrients, which are beneficial for enhancing immunity, preventing c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ases, and promoting digestion. Consuming them together is beneficial to health.

For individuals with sensitive digestive systems or weak gastrointestinal function, both bitter melon and cauliflower have relatively high plant fiber content. Excessive consumption may lead to indigestion or bloating. Additionally, bitter melon has blood sugar-lowering properties, so individuals with hypoglycemia should consume it in moderation to avoid adverse reactions. Some individuals may be allergic to either bitter melon or cauliflower, in which case it is not recommended to consume them together.

In daily diets, maintaining diversity and balanced nutrient intake is key. It is also important to pay attention to individual body constitution and reactions, and adjust the dietary structure accordingly.
